This is from the 2021 Topps Chrome Update set. I usually like the autographs out of the Chrome products, because they are usually on-card signatures. Well, this one is not. Kind of disappointing, but I guess not all that surprising that Topps would find a way to disappoint on a set that I enjoy.  

Snell still had a large amount of Rays autographs last year with a few Padres autographs sprinkled into the mix. I think that every single Padres autograph released so far is a sticker autograph. Snell was traded to the Padres at the end of December 2020 just weeks before the first 2021 baseball cards were released. My guess is that he signed a bunch of Rays cards during the off-season for early Topps card products along with a bunch of stickers. Topps used the stickers in later releases for the Padres autographs.  

Snell has always signed a ton of cards. I bet he gets some on-card Padres autographs this year.
